Problems solved by technology

[0003] Existing tree diggers include portable chainsaw type, side screw-in type and down-insert type, etc. The portable chainsaw type still requires manual and laborious operation, and the soil balls dug out without experience are not round and the efficiency is not high; The size of the side screw-in and down-insert soil balls cannot be adjusted. When digging a tree on a certain slope without an angle adjustment device, the tree dug out will be eccentric, and it will not be able to dig when encountering stones and large roots.

Abstract

The invention discloses a tree excavating machine outer meshing rotating driving device. The tree excavating machine outer meshing rotating driving device comprises an upper bearing ring, a lower bearing ring, a driving motor, a worm and gear reducing mechanism and a transfer case. The lower bearing ring is rotationally installed at the bottom of the upper bearing ring. One side of the upper bearing ring and one side of the lower bearing ring are provided with openings with the same angle. The two ends of the transfer case are each rotationally provided with a transmission shaft. The lower ends of the transmission shafts are provided with gears respectively. The lower bearing ring is provided with an outer gear ring. The gears are meshed with the outer gear ring and located at the two sides of the opening in one side of the lower bearing ring. By means of the tree excavating machine outer meshing rotating driving device, it is guaranteed that an excavated soil ball is very round, a large tree root can be sawed off, stone and other barriers can be conveyed out through a chain, and the tree excavating machine outer meshing rotating driving device will not get stuck easily; it is guaranteed that a tree excavating machine can be provided with an angle adjusting device, the tree excavating machine can conduct excavating on the ground with certain slope, the excavated soil ball can meet the requirement for tree transplanting, and the problems of excavating and transplanting of seedlings on the conditions of hills, mountain slopes and the like are solved.

technical field [0001] The invention relates to the field of tree digging machines, in particular to an external meshing rotary driving device of the tree digging machine. Background technique [0002] With the acceleration of the process of agricultural mechanization, various types of agricultural machinery have entered into production practice one after another. At present, in addition to the production and processing of field crops and some economic crops, in addition to the use of operating machinery, most forestry nursery operations need light, high-efficiency tree-digging machinery to replace the increasingly scarce rural labor resources and improve operating efficiency. quality and efficiency. my country has a vast territory, not only in topography, landform, geological soil structure, but also in the characteristics of plants in various places.
